Transaction 61f3271b885dc998fb73908f1ff550e12bba973726afb6567a738768f3868362

1 Input
2 Outputs
  • 61f3271b885dc998fb73908f1ff550e12bba973726afb6567a738768f3868362:0
  • value  8368952
    address  36MpCVKCyGWB9C8tyaUkYMQ2BCuPgBzj1s
  • 61f3271b885dc998fb73908f1ff550e12bba973726afb6567a738768f3868362:1
  • value  2556010
    address  33ZM73CNWdL4gcyfGGEnXDwSsjcWdVQMcq